Data-Driven Strategies for Accurate Patient Outcome Prediction

Predicting patient outcomes has become a crucial part of modern healthcare. By using data-driven methods, healthcare professionals can identify risks early, enhance treatment accuracy, and ensure better recovery rates. Patient outcome prediction involves analyzing medical data, patient history, and lifestyle factors to anticipate health results with higher precision. This proactive approach not only improves patient care but also helps hospitals and clinics allocate resources more effectively. As medical records and health analytics continue to expand, data-driven prediction models are transforming how care is delivered, ensuring decisions are based on evidence rather than assumptions.

Key Components of Data-Driven Patient Outcome Prediction

A successful patient outcome prediction system relies on several essential components that work together to generate accurate insights.

  1. Comprehensive Data Collection
    Collecting quality data from multiple sources is the foundation of reliable predictions. This includes:

    • Electronic health records (EHRs)
    • Diagnostic test results
    • Lifestyle and behavioral data
    • Wearable device readings
    • Genomic and demographic information
  2. Data Integration and Cleansing
    Combining data from different healthcare systems requires careful integration. Raw medical data often contains errors, duplicates, or incomplete records. Data cleansing ensures the model works with accurate, consistent, and relevant information.
  3. Machine Learning and AI Models
    Machine learning algorithms identify patterns in medical data that humans might overlook. Using models like regression, decision trees, and neural networks, these systems can detect disease risks or treatment outcomes with high precision.
  4. Predictive Analytics Tools
    Predictive analytics platforms analyze large datasets to provide real-time insights. These tools can help forecast readmission risks, predict recovery times, and even recommend personalized treatment plans.

Steps to Develop a Data-Driven Prediction Framework

Building an effective patient outcome prediction framework requires structured planning and implementation.

Step 1: Define the Objectives
Before collecting data, healthcare teams must define clear goals. For example, predicting hospital readmission rates or identifying patients at risk of chronic diseases.

Step 2: Gather and Secure Data
Data security and privacy are critical in healthcare. All patient data should comply with HIPAA and GDPR standards to maintain confidentiality.

Step 3: Choose Suitable Predictive Models
Selecting the right machine learning model depends on the type of data and the prediction goal. For example:

  • Logistic regression for binary outcomes (e.g., survival or non-survival)
  • Random forest for handling complex datasets
  • Deep learning for imaging or genetic data analysis

Step 4: Train and Validate the Model
Training the model with high-quality data improves its predictive power. Continuous validation ensures accuracy over time as new data becomes available.

Step 5: Monitor and Update Regularly
Healthcare data evolves rapidly. Regular updates and retraining keep the model relevant and aligned with new medical discoveries or changing patient demographics.

Real-World Applications in Healthcare

Data-driven patient outcome prediction is already transforming multiple areas of healthcare practice.

  • Early Disease Detection: Predictive models help identify diseases like diabetes, cancer, or heart conditions before symptoms appear.
  • Personalized Treatment Plans: By analyzing patient-specific data, clinicians can tailor treatments based on genetic and lifestyle factors.
  • Reduced Hospital Readmissions: Predictive analytics can identify patients likely to be readmitted and guide interventions to prevent it.
  • Optimized Resource Allocation: Hospitals can forecast patient needs, ensuring optimal staff and equipment availability.
  • Remote Patient Monitoring: With IoT and wearable technologies, real-time data helps track patient health outside hospital settings.

Benefits of Data-Driven Patient Outcome Prediction

Using data-driven strategies offers numerous advantages for both healthcare providers and patients.

  1. Enhanced Accuracy: Machine learning models analyze vast amounts of data quickly, reducing human error and improving diagnostic precision.
  2. Improved Patient Safety: Predictive alerts notify medical teams of potential complications before they occur.
  3. Cost Efficiency: By predicting outcomes and preventing unnecessary hospitalizations, healthcare systems can save significant costs.
  4. Personalized Care: Data analytics enables physicians to design treatments based on individual patient profiles, improving recovery rates.
  5. Continuous Improvement: Real-time feedback and predictive insights help medical institutions continuously refine their clinical practices.

Challenges in Implementing Predictive Models

While data-driven healthcare offers immense potential, it also presents several challenges:

  • Data Privacy and Ethics: Ensuring compliance with data protection regulations is essential.
  • Model Transparency: Healthcare providers must understand how AI reaches its conclusions to maintain trust.
  • Integration Issues: Many hospitals still use outdated systems that are difficult to integrate with modern predictive tools.
  • Bias in Data: Incomplete or skewed datasets can lead to biased outcomes, affecting treatment fairness.
  • Training Requirements: Medical professionals need proper training to interpret and act on predictive insights effectively.

Future of Patient Outcome Prediction

The future of healthcare prediction lies in more advanced AI models, real-time analytics, and integrated digital health systems. Emerging technologies like federated learning and quantum computing are expected to make predictions even faster and more accurate. As healthcare organizations adopt these tools, patient care will become more personalized, efficient, and proactive. Data-driven prediction is not just a technological trend—it’s a new era in preventive medicine.
